What recent reviews say

Reviewers consistently experience warm, attentive care at prices that surprise them on the low side. Dr. Sara Wenkheimer and her team explain procedures clearly, send follow-up calls, and deliver polished results on spays, neuters, and dental work.

The clinic specializes in affordable dental and surgical care for dogs and cats. Multiple reviewers note transparency in pricing and the owner's genuine commitment to animal welfare. Three complaints surface: facility cleanliness, an alleged injury, and the requirement to schedule a separate pre-surgery wellness exam rather than combining it with the procedure.

Common questions

How much does a dental cleaning cost?
Dental cleaning starts at $600 all-inclusive, covering a 10-panel bloodwork panel, sedation, X-rays, exam, cleaning, and take-home medications. Tooth extractions add $25-75 per tooth.
Do I need a separate appointment for a pre-surgery check?
Yes, the clinic requires a separate pre-surgery wellness visit (costs $35) scheduled before spay, neuter, or dental procedures.
Does the clinic call after my pet's surgery?
Yes, staff call to check up on your pet after procedures like dental extractions or spay/neuter work.
